Overview
Embark on a captivating 50-minute master class led by 2020 Nobel Laureate astrophysicist Andrea Ghez, exploring the supermassive black hole at the center of the Milky Way. Delve into Ghez's groundbreaking research and discover the crucial role black holes play in the formation and evolution of galaxies. Recorded at the 2018 World Science Festival in New York City, this lecture offers a unique opportunity to learn from a leading expert in the field. For those seeking a deeper understanding, access the associated free online course available at World Science U to further expand your knowledge of this fascinating cosmic phenomenon.
